2004 Nissan Maxima SE review from North America
What things have gone wrong with the car?
I have a 2004 Nissan Maxima, of course out of warranty, and all hell breaks loose.. in and out of the shop every other month since the warranty expired.
Now I have the same transmission problems as everyone else on this site. Go up hill.. no way it got over 20 hardly.
Auto shift stuck in 5th yes... engine stalling, hard to start. Took it in, well it's still there; they said it's the cam sensor and the crank shaft sensor, two parts under 90 bucks each, and they want 700 dollars to replace them! OK, so I pay it? And what comes in November? I might as well have a car payment since I am paying out chunks every other month for repairs..
Obviously this is an issue with this make of vehicle. What will it take to get Nissan to recognize it and perhaps a recall! By the way, they did say my tranny looks good.
